What Kroger-Albertsons merger means for competition, prices, and the local community
International Business Times: Anat Alon-Beck, assistant professor of law, said the Kroger-Albertsons merger would create a new giant, which could change the grocery sector in several ways. “It will leave the local communities—consumers and workers—worse off,” she said. “All you have to do is just look at the recent Safeway example.”
